SQL Server全文搜索是一种在SQL Server数据库中进行文本搜索的功能。它允许用户在数据库中搜索包含一个或多个关键词的文本数据。
SQL Server全文搜索的优势包括:
- 高效性:全文搜索使用索引和内置算法,可以快速地搜索大量的文本数据,提高搜索效率。
- 精确性:全文搜索支持多种搜索方式,包括全文搜索、模糊搜索、近似搜索等,可以根据用户的需求进行精确的搜索。
- 多语言支持:SQL Server全文搜索支持多种语言的文本搜索,包括中文、英文、日文等,可以满足不同语言环境下的搜索需求。
- 高度可定制化:SQL Server全文搜索提供了丰富的配置选项,可以根据具体的需求进行定制,包括搜索范围、搜索算法、搜索权重等。
SQL Server全文搜索的应用场景包括:
- 网站搜索:可以用于网站的搜索功能,提供快速、准确的搜索结果。
- 文档管理:可以用于对大量文档进行全文搜索,方便用户快速找到需要的文档。
- 日志分析:可以用于对系统日志进行搜索和分析,帮助用户快速定位问题。
- 社交媒体分析:可以用于对社交媒体数据进行搜索和分析,提取有价值的信息。
腾讯云提供了一系列与SQL Server全文搜索相关的产品和服务,包括:
- 云数据库SQL Server:提供了完全托管的SQL Server数据库服务,支持全文搜索功能。详细信息请参考:https://cloud.tencent.com/product/cdb_sqlserver
- 云搜索:提供了全文搜索引擎服务,支持多种搜索功能,包括文本搜索、模糊搜索等。详细信息请参考:https://cloud.tencent.com/product/css
- 云文档检索:提供了文档检索服务,支持对大量文档进行全文搜索和检索。详细信息请参考:https://cloud.tencent.com/product/cdrs
以上是关于SQL Server全文搜索的概念、分类、优势、应用场景以及腾讯云相关产品的介绍。希望对您有所帮助。